How do I make it?

In a large pot of salted water, boil potatoes for 10 minutes, until fork tender. Drain potatoes, add them back to the pot, and move to a cool burner. Shake the pot around a bit to let off some of that excess steam, mash potatoes with a masher to get your desired consistency.

Slowly pour in half and half, stir to combine. Add in all other ingredients, mix well, and serve Creamy Mashed Potatoes with green onion if desired! Enjoy!

Tips:

  • You can use whatever potato you want, it doesn’t really matter!
  • If you don’t have half and half, splash in some milk instead. Cream cheese is another yummy addition along with sour cream!
  • If you don’t have green onion, stir in some chives instead! Alternatively, some minced parsley would be a great garnish!

Ingredients
  

  • 2 lbs baby red potatoes – washed and scrubbed partially peeled, and diced
  • ยฝ cup half and half
  • ยผ cup butter
  • ยผ cup shredded cheddar
  • 1 tsp salt
  • ยผ tsp black pepper
  • ยผ tsp oregano
  • ยผ tsp garlic powder

Optional garnishes:

  • green onion

Instructions
 

  • In a large pot of salted water, boil potatoes for 10 minutes, until fork tender
  • Drain potatoes, add them back to the pot, and move to a cool burner
  • Shake the pot around a bit to let off some of that excess steam, mash potatoes with a masher to get your desired consistency
  • Slowly pour in half and half, and stir to combine
  • Add in all other ingredients, mix well, and serve Creamy Mashed Potatoes with green onion if desired!
